geekayhu
Forum Replies Created
-
Hi Arif,
Thank you for your help, and sorry for the delay, we’ve been extremely busy.
The solution seems to work, so thank you for the fix.
Kind regards
GabeHi Arif,
First of all, thank you for your response and the fix. However, a question before I use this version (it may sound silly, sorry): I uploaded the v5.1.29 version with the fix you shared, but WP sees it as a “different version” (Premium), not a simple update (screenshot: https://ibb.co/Hpk24J2x) – meaning it did not ask me to “update” the previous one, but installed as a “new plugin”)
My concern: do I have to deactivate v5.1.26? Would not be a conflict? The reason for being cautious is because we have an upcoming event (7 Feb) with many registrations, already, and I we don’t wanna accidentally lose regs.
Thanks for your assistance!
Kind regards
GabeHi Arif,
Thank you again for your quick response, and efforts.
Kind regards,
GabeHi Arif,
Thank you for your quick response.
Unfortunately, I tried it previously, and checked that for example in our case: the “EN – Magasvérnyomás” (“High blood pressure consultation”) is #9, so definitely should not be the first.
screenshot: https://ibb.co/60YcyvQw
And as I mentioned it only seems to be “buggy” with the category shortcode. I had no problem when we used the [webbabooking] “main” shortcode on a different global event.
Kind regards
GabeHi Arif,
Thank you very much for the update.
- the v6.1.1 seems to work just fine for now (we received the “copy of the confirmation email”;
- regarding the 5.1.26, also thanks for the upcoming fix.
Kind regards
GabeAnd thank YOU for inspecting these thoroughly.
Have a great day!
Gabe
Hi Abdullah,
Thank you for your efforts and bug fixes.
Related to (3) the double booking issue: I just attach a screenshot of the time zone settings.
I will also get in touch with you at the given support email, which I’m grateful for.
Thank you!
Regards
GabeHi Abdullah,
Thank you for “reopening” this support ticket, and responding to my issues; and ofc, for the later fixes where possible. I try to be as brief as possible, but still as detailed.
Re: Basic issues
- Re: “The available dates should display correctly in the current month. I’ll need to check your page directly to confirm how it appears on your setup.”
- Please let me know how I can assist with the check.
- I took another screencast of what is happening, so you don’t have to watch the whole thing again: https://youtu.be/KxxiEaZPD2Q
- steps: 1) open the booking -> it currently shows September; 2) jump to October -> it loads times from November (but with 2025.11.15 – which is correct); 3) go back to September, and reopen October again -> now the dates disappear (vs previously), and it looks fine. If that matters: I cleared both the server and browser cache several times
- Re: “translation strings didn’t work”: What I meant is that in v6, there is no “name” field in the backend for the name to translate (in v5.x you have only 1 field for the name, in v6 – in the frontend, you have 2 fields for first AND last names): https://ibb.co/jksCrGmQ (previous screenshot: https://ibb.co/cSJV1kH4)
Re: Backend
- Re: “dashboard booking list is displaying fine”: well, I quickly made a booking, it’s still empty for me: https://drive.google.com/file/d/1zuH2XDUpkDGsCg7YobWBhtU34RbZlINh/view?usp=sharing (as mentioned, I cleared both caches several times) Re: Email notifications
- Re: “The email notification issue has been partly reproduced. I’ll run further tests, and if confirmed, it will be fixed.” Thank you!
- Re: “Couldn’t reproduce the test email”: maybe I do something wrong, but here’s what I tried (as you can see, that booking is also missing from the “made in the 24 hrs list, maybe because it’s made by admin?): https://youtu.be/dyHFSVww74k (I also received the confirmation email, so it is booked, but can’t find it for test-sending)
Re: Current Email Template
- Re: “I couldn’t reproduce the issue you mentioned. When booking 2 timeslots, the system correctly picked the first one from start to cancellation [screenshot] and [screenshot-2]“
- Your screenshot -> this seems to be 2 separate bookings for me. What I mentioned is that “2 timeslots within 1 booking”, so I have 2 cancellation links within the confirmation email, so the customer can cancel just 1 if they want to keep the other.https://youtu.be/XBhPF6BrXE8
- but, the “solo” booking with only one timeslot returns a wrong date, too (-> 2025.11.14, we have no consultation on that day): https://youtu.be/I-Zw4WRoDl0
- Maybe the “placeholders” inherited from v5.x are not compatible with v6?
- this part: “[appointment_loop_start]
#appointment_day • #appointment_time — #cancel_link[appointment_loop_end]
- Re: “It’s possible since we’re updating from v5 to v6. I’ll discuss the inherited template with our development team to confirm if it’s related.” Thank you!
- this part: “[appointment_loop_start]
Thank you for your assistance!
Kind regards
GabeHi there,
I’m sorry, but there is nothing resolved, since, if you read our communication, you just wrote ” Some of your points are absolutely valid, while others may need a closer look. We’ll carefully review all your observations, there’s always room for improvement” – so I haven’t received any solution to the issues I mentioned, and you did not ask anything else.
Thanks
Kind regards, GabeHi Anca,
Thank you for your response.
With the v2.10.3 update, it works fine so far.Thank you!
Kind regards,
GabeHi there,
This happened on our sites, too. We switched back to “Load legacy Language Switcher” (in the advanced settings/troubleshooting), as a temporary fix.
Hope it helps for now.
GabeHi Antonio,
Thank you very much for your quick response and assistance.
Based on your suggestion, I checked what may block the content (browser console), and I found the culprit. It was a bit strange because I have a Chrome extension “uBlock Origin Lite”, and it works on other sites without blocking Complianz (no issue with riavita.com in the video), but it does block Complianz on ceosz.hu (and on another – not SiteGround – site) I sent the issue about.
Just for reference, I took another screencast (with the console open):
As you can see, 2 sites don’t work with uBlock “ON”, but riavita.com does work with uBlock activated, that is why I did not think it could be a content blocker (still don’t understand why it works this way TBH).
There was a bit of a misunderstanding (“You mentioned being able to bypass the issue by manually removing”) –> NO, I wasn’t, just tried, but it rewrote itself. Anyway, does not matter now, since I just had to disable uBlock.So, I guess it is resolved. Thank you for you time, and sorry that I did not realize this sooner, but as I mentioned, I wouldn’t have thought that once uBlock blocks, the other time it does not (strange).
Kind regards
Gabeupd: unfortunately, with the latest v7.4.2 update, the backend is still not loading, however, the changelog says “Fix: Backend not loading due to missing dependency on WordPress versions lower than 6.6.”
Kind regards
GabeHi,
Thank you for the follow-up — you were right to ask!
We do have a custom code snippet (see below) in place that hides all other shipping methods only when Free Shipping is available:
/**Hide shipping rates when free shipping is available.
*Updated to support WooCommerce 2.6 Shipping Zones.
*@param array $rates Array of rates found for the package.
*@return array
*/function my_hide_shipping_when_free_is_available( $rates ) {
$free = array();
foreach ( $rates as $rate_id => $rate ) {
if ( ‘free_shipping’ === $rate->method_id ) {
$free[ $rate_id ] = $rate;
break;
}
}
return ! empty( $free ) ? $free : $rates;
}
add_filter( ‘woocommerce_package_rates’, ‘my_hide_shipping_when_free_is_available’, 100 );The reason we added this was purely UX-related: by default, WooCommerce sometimes lists Free Shipping after the paid methods, or makes the user manually select it — even when they clearly qualify for it. That can be confusing and doesn’t feel intuitive to the customer. So we applied this override to make Free Shipping automatically selected and displayed on its own when it’s valid.
That said, based on the recent issue, we now suspect this behavior might contribute to the problem, especially if Free Shipping is incorrectly triggered (due to a caching quirk or logic conflict), and the snippet then hides the correct paid options.
Pls let me know if you’d recommend an alternative approach to preserve UX while avoiding this conflict.
Thanks again!
GabeI recreated the whole page from scratch, because my client could not wait. It seems to work now.
Have a great day.
Gabe